Notes: This is an audience shot DVD from the 2004 Tour with superb production and an incredible performance. As far as audience filmed videos go, this is fantastic work and reflects by far the best audience recorded Clapton DVD to date (the name to remember here is ?Scratchmonkey?. These guys did an awesome job!). Filmed with two cameras, seamlessly edited together, the viewer is treated to both wide shots of the stage area and close-ups of the multi camera video from the screens, which is so vivid and sharp that at times it would fool many into thinking this material had been pro-shot. Letterboxing the image really adds a nice touch. To cap it off, there is a beautiful authoring job complete with splash screen, full menus and track indices. Sound is passable, but unfortunately not up to par with the excellent video quality. Still, this is far beyond the realm of the average fan-type concert DVD and something that anyone will enjoy. Performance wise, all you need to do is to look at EC's face! Playing in his adopted hometown, with friends and family in attendance, EC took a break during a sweet rendition of "Walk Out in the Rain" to wave to his wife and children, who had just walked down the aisle and were waving to him. The performances that night by all involved were superb, making this easily one of the finest performances of the 2004 tour. In short, if you plan to only watch one document of the 2004 EC tour - this is the one. Highly recommended. For more info, check out: http://geetarz.org/reviews/clapton/2004-07-12-columbus-dvd.htm
